About C.S. Cox

C.S. Cox is a scholar working on Control and Systems Engineering, Mechanical Engineering, Artificial Intelligence, Industrial and Manufacturing Engineering and Civil and Structural Engineering, having authored 56 papers that have together received 267 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Fault Detection and Control Systems (22 papers), Advanced Control Systems Optimization (13 papers), Advanced Control Systems Design (10 papers), Control Systems and Identification (10 papers), Hydraulic and Pneumatic Systems (7 papers), Real-time simulation and control systems (6 papers), Neural Networks and Applications (6 papers) and Water Quality Monitoring and Analysis (6 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Control and Systems Engineering (144 citations), Water Science and Technology (34 citations), Industrial and Manufacturing Engineering (17 citations), Artificial Intelligence (55 citations) and Mechanical Engineering (49 citations). C.S. Cox has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om, Germany and China. Frequent co-authors include Ian French, Christos Emmanouilidis, John MacIntyre, Andrew Hunter, Ian Fletcher, Thomas Böhme, Michael Short, Josef Börcsök, Elizabeth Freeman and M.J. Willis. Their work appears in journals such as Applied Mathematical Modelling, Kybernetika, Process Safety and Environmental Protection, Control Engineering Practice and Natural Computing.
